What this strategy does
Long entrywhen all of these are true
- RSI(14) crosses above 30
- close is above EMA200
Exit
- 1.stop loss at -2%
- 2.take profit at +4%
If several conditions hit on the same candle, the one listed first applies.

How to read this honestly
- 6 of 6 coins traded fewer than 100 times, so their numbers carry wide error bars.
- Only 9 of 47 coin-and-period cells were profitable.
- 5 of 6 coins carried volatility without being paid for it.
- The worst losing streak ran 15 trades in a row.
